CUNY Brooklyn College sits in Brooklyn, NY.

During the most recent reporting year, 177 general accounting graduations were recorded at CUNY Brooklyn College.

Studying Online at CUNY Brooklyn College

Many students take online classes at CUNY Brooklyn College. Among 14,390 students, 2,086 (14%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 6,308 (44%) took at least some classes online.

General Accounting Bachelor’s Program at CUNY Brooklyn College

Of the 152 bachelor’s general accounting graduates at CUNY Brooklyn College, 47% were women (71) and 53% were men (81).

CUNY Brooklyn College gender breakdown of General Accounting Bachelor's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of General Accounting bachelor’s degree recipients at CUNY Brooklyn College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 35
Hispanic / Latino 19
Black / African American 13
Asian 75
Two or More Races 6
International (Nonresident) 4
Racial-ethnic diversity of General Accounting majors at CUNY Brooklyn College

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 74% of General Accounting bachelor’s degree recipients at CUNY Brooklyn College, higher than the national average of 35%.*

General Accounting Master’s Program at CUNY Brooklyn College

Of the 25 master’s general accounting degrees awarded at CUNY Brooklyn College, 72% were women (18) and 28% were men (7).

CUNY Brooklyn College gender breakdown of General Accounting Master's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of General Accounting master’s degree recipients at CUNY Brooklyn College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 2
Hispanic / Latino 4
Black / African American 5
Asian 10
Two or More Races 1
International (Nonresident) 3
Racial-ethnic diversity of General Accounting majors at CUNY Brooklyn College

Minority students account for 80% of General Accounting master’s degree recipients at CUNY Brooklyn College, higher than the national average of 35%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
